Houston Texans vs Buffalo Bills: Prediction, Head-to-Head, Odds & Stats (Fri, 21 Nov '25)
Wojtek Kolan
Published on 21 Nov, 01:15 AM UTC
Next Match 21/11/25 at 01:15 AM
Houston Texans vs Buffalo Bills
📍 NRG Stadium, USA.
Scheduled H2H Match For Houston Texans Vs Buffalo Bills
NFL
Fri, 21 Nov 2025 at 01:15 AM UTC
Houston Texans
USA
Recent Form
W
W
L
W
L
6
Win
Last 10 Played
10
0 Draws4
Win
20
Position
8
DeMeco Ryans
Manager
Sean McDermott
Buffalo Bills
USA
Recent Form
W
L
L
W
W
6
Win
Last 10 Played
10
0 Draws4
Win
20
Position
8
DeMeco Ryans
Manager
Sean McDermott
Game Schedule - Time Of Fixture
Houston Texans will square off vs Buffalo Bills in NFL on Fri, 21 Nov 2025 at 01:15 AM UTC. Let’s investigate historical performances, recent stats and head-2-head information to find out the most accurate picks and best bets.
Houston Texans vs Buffalo Bills H2H Results Summary
Analyzing the last 10 head to head games for these teams, Houston Texans have come out on top 6 times and Buffalo Bills have won on 4 occasion. In the latest fixture between them, Houston Texans won 23-20.
| Head-to-Head (Last 10 Matches) | |
|---|---|
| Houston Texans | 6 |
| Buffalo Bills | 4 |
Houston Texans vs Buffalo Bills Past H2H Matches
NFL
Houston Texans Recent Matches
NFL (26 Matches)
NFL Preseason (3 Matches)
Buffalo Bills Recent Matches
NFL (26 Matches)
NFL Preseason (3 Matches)
Houston Texans Next Fixtures
NFL
Buffalo Bills Next Fixtures
NFL
Houston Texans Last Match Played stats
Houston Texans vs Jacksonville Jaguars
Final Score :36 - 29
| (H) | Offense | (A) |
|---|---|---|
| 5 | Touchdowns | 3 |
| 1/1 | Field goals | 3/3 |
| 412 | Total yards | 213 |
| 2 | Turnovers | 2 |
| 4/5 | Red zone efficiency | 2/4 |
| 31:00 | Time of Possession | 29:00 |
| 27 | First downs | 19 |
| 6 | First downs by penalty | 2 |
| 10/15 (66%) | Third down efficiency | 4/11 (36%) |
| 2 | Punts | 3 |
| 54 | Average yards per punt | 45.7 |
| 6 | Average yards per play | 3.9 |
| (H) | Passing | (A) |
| 17 | First downs by passing | 7 |
| 282 | Net yards passing | 119 |
| 292 | Gross yards passing | 158 |
| 2 | Passing touchdowns | 1 |
| 1 | Interceptions thrown | 1 |
| 6 | Average passing yards per attempt | 4.3 |
| 11 | Red zone passing attempts | 4 |
| (H) | Rushing | (A) |
| 22 | Rushing attempts | 27 |
| 130 | Rushing yards | 94 |
| 5.9 | Average rushing yards per attempt | 3.5 |
| 8 | First downs by rushing | 6 |
| 5 | Red zone rushing attempts | 9 |
| (H) | Other | (A) |
| 11 | Penalties | 9 |
| 80 | Yards penalized | 90 |
| 2 | Fumbles | 2 |
| 1 | Fumbles lost | 1 |
Buffalo Bills Last Match Played stats
Miami Dolphins vs Buffalo Bills
Final Score :30 - 13
| (H) | Offense | (A) |
|---|---|---|
| 4 | Touchdowns | 2 |
| 1/1 | Field goals | 0/0 |
| 370 | Total yards | 376 |
| 2 | Turnovers | 3 |
| 1/1 | Red zone efficiency | 0/1 |
| 28:37 | Time of Possession | 31:23 |
| 19 | First downs | 20 |
| 4 | First downs by penalty | 1 |
| 3/9 (33%) | Third down efficiency | 5/15 (33%) |
| 3 | Punts | 4 |
| 51 | Average yards per punt | 54.3 |
| 7 | Average yards per play | 5.8 |
| (H) | Passing | (A) |
| 9 | First downs by passing | 12 |
| 173 | Net yards passing | 289 |
| 173 | Gross yards passing | 306 |
| 2 | Passing touchdowns | 2 |
| 2 | Interceptions thrown | 1 |
| 8.2 | Average passing yards per attempt | 6.7 |
| 1 | Red zone passing attempts | 2 |
| (H) | Rushing | (A) |
| 32 | Rushing attempts | 22 |
| 197 | Rushing yards | 87 |
| 6.2 | Average rushing yards per attempt | 4 |
| 9 | First downs by rushing | 4 |
| 2 | Red zone rushing attempts | 3 |
| (H) | Other | (A) |
| 5 | Penalties | 6 |
| 35 | Yards penalized | 67 |
| 0 | Fumbles | 2 |
| 0 | Fumbles lost | 2 |
NFL 25/26 Standings
| POS | TEAM | MP | W | L | D | PTS |
|---|---|---|---|---|---|---|
| 1 | 10 | 8 | 2 | 0 | 0.8 | |
| 2 | 10 | 8 | 2 | 0 | 0.8 | |
| 3 | 10 | 8 | 2 | 0 | 0.8 | |
| 4 | 8 | 6 | 2 | 0 | 0.75 | |
| 5 | 8 | 6 | 2 | 0 | 0.75 | |
| 6 | 8 | 6 | 2 | 0 | 0.75 | |
| 7 | 8 | 5 | 2 | 1 | 0.688 | |
| 8 | 9 | 6 | 3 | 0 | 0.667 | |
| 9 | 9 | 6 | 3 | 0 | 0.667 | |
| 10 | 9 | 6 | 3 | 0 | 0.667 | |
| 11 | 9 | 6 | 3 | 0 | 0.667 | |
| 12 | 9 | 6 | 3 | 0 | 0.667 | |
| 13 | 8 | 5 | 3 | 0 | 0.625 | |
| 14 | 8 | 5 | 3 | 0 | 0.625 | |
| 15 | 9 | 5 | 4 | 0 | 0.556 | |
| 16 | 9 | 5 | 4 | 0 | 0.556 | |
| 17 | 10 | 5 | 5 | 0 | 0.5 | |
| 18 | 9 | 4 | 5 | 0 | 0.444 | |
| 19 | 9 | 4 | 5 | 0 | 0.444 | |
| 20 | 9 | 4 | 5 | 0 | 0.444 | |
| 21 | 9 | 3 | 5 | 1 | 0.389 | |
| 22 | 8 | 3 | 5 | 0 | 0.375 | |
| 23 | 9 | 3 | 6 | 0 | 0.333 | |
| 24 | 9 | 3 | 6 | 0 | 0.333 | |
| 25 | 9 | 3 | 6 | 0 | 0.333 | |
| 26 | 10 | 3 | 7 | 0 | 0.3 | |
| 27 | 9 | 2 | 7 | 0 | 0.222 | |
| 28 | 9 | 2 | 7 | 0 | 0.222 | |
| 29 | 9 | 2 | 7 | 0 | 0.222 | |
| 30 | 10 | 2 | 8 | 0 | 0.2 | |
| 31 | 10 | 2 | 8 | 0 | 0.2 | |
| 32 | 9 | 1 | 8 | 0 | 0.111 |